#6b960d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b960d is composed of 42% red, 58.8%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 78.8 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 32%. #6b960d color hex could be obtained by blending #d6ff1a with #002d00.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#6b960d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b960d has RGB values of R:107, G:150,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 7050765.

Shades and Tints of #6b960d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040600 is the darkest color, while #fafef3 is the lightest one.
